The Economy…well…SUCKS

Given the state of the current economy, what steps have you
taken this semester in order to conserve money? What sort of pressures
does this apply to your day-to-day routine?

The state of the economy is very dire and thus I have taken many steps to try and conserve money. Just conserving money, however, in this current situation perturbs me. This is because my personal economic belief, when it comes to recessions, is the society should spend their way out of it. This deals with many complicated economic theories and do not belong in this article. The steps previously stated that I partake in include: not going out to eat, cutting out spending on excess items, shying away from upgrading electronics, and spending less on Christmas presents. The economy has also forced me into a very tight position. The source of all my money for college has dried up because of the stock market crash, thus I now have to take out loans. I am a movie producer and because of this I will not make money for at least five years out of college. How am I supposed to feel comfortable taking out loans when I know I will be coach surfing until I am twenty-seven? This adds an insane amount of pressure when it comes to school and the future. As to school, now I am graduating in three years and killing myself for the best grades possible (for scholarship). The two previous statements are not the worst; the worst is that there is always a worry in the back of my head that the money is just not going to be there when the bills come. As to the future, I now have to make sure whatever job I have makes enough to support loan payments. This will probably mean working multiple jobs for at least three years. The day to day pressures seem very easy to deal with compared to the future which does not look bright. I never realized the recession effected everyone; I thought I was a solitary case. However, this idea was drastically changed when the dean of students requested a meeting with a group of students in my dorm. I attended and told my story and others told theirs. Every student was negatively effected by the state of the economy. This effect was not small of every nominal in each story. Every student’s financial situation has drastically changed for the worst in the past six months.
